Low Plasma Cholesterol Linked to Less Risk of High-Grade Prostate Cancer

October 10th, 2008 · No Comments

Lower plasma cholesterol levels are associated with a decreased risk of high-grade prostate cancer, according to study findings published in the October issue of the International Journal of Cancer. Reuters Health Information
